Vocational skills upgrading training subsidies Employers provide pre-job training for new employees. Where the registered unemployed and rural workers who seek jobs in cities are recruited and sign labor contracts with them for more than six months, and the employer organizes pre-job training in vocational training institutions and obtains vocational training certificates (or vocational qualification certificates), the employer can enjoy certain vocational training subsidies. The employer shall apply for training subsidies in writing to the employment service management institution of the county (district) with the application materials for training subsidies for upgrading vocational skills. The employing unit applying for vocational skills upgrading training subsidy shall attach: the materials required for individual application, the roster of trainees, the list of persons enjoying subsidies, and a copy of the labor contract.
